Definitions:

Quality Loss Function

highlights the losses incurred by deviating from the optimal product quality level, emphasizing that loss increases as the product moves away from what is considered the target value.

Cause-and-Effect Diagram

A visual tool for identifying and organizing the potential causes of a problem in order to identify its root causes, also known as a fishbone or Ishikawa diagram.

Service Quality

The degree to which a service meets the customer's expectations, often evaluated based on factors like responsiveness, reliability, and professionalism.
